Subject: [PATCH] sched/wake_q: Provide WAKE_Q_HEAD_INITIALIZER()
Git-commit: 2c8bb85151d4bad825f8962792e9f53d22db81db
Patch-mainline: v5.15-rc1
References: bsc#1190137 bsc#1189998

The RT specific spin/rwlock implementation requires special handling of the
to be woken waiters. Provide a WAKE_Q_HEAD_INITIALIZER(), which can be used by
the rtmutex code to implement an RT aware wake_q derivative.
